Output e95e60cf825031db43d11ce26d831fccc9a51431aa48c3af0fc5a6dd8ab7899f:1

value
49530647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6086e30c1f25e71546e844e039f5e51d7b3dc1a6 OP_EQUAL
address
MGhYgxBjMceZBLkZFYRDErFjWDrS1oH8Ms
transaction
e95e60cf825031db43d11ce26d831fccc9a51431aa48c3af0fc5a6dd8ab7899f
spent
true